阿里云Windows服务器默认无图形化界面,但可手动安装
结论:阿里云提供的Windows Server镜像默认不包含图形化界面(GUI),但用户可通过PowerShell或管理控制台手动安装。这一设计旨在降低资源占用,提升服务器性能,适合以命令行管理为主的场景。
核心原因与现状
-
默认无GUI的考量:
- 资源优化:图形化界面会占用额外CPU、内存和存储(约1-2GB空间),影响服务器运行效率。
- 安全性与轻量化:无GUI减少攻击面,符合云服务器最小化安装的最佳实践。
- 成本控制:阿里云按配置计费,无GUI可降低基础资源开销。
-
支持的操作系统版本:
- Windows Server 2012/2016/2019/2022均提供Core版本(无GUI)和Desktop Experience版本(带GUI),但阿里云默认选择Core。
如何安装图形化界面?
方法一:通过PowerShell(推荐)
# 安装GUI基础组件
Install-WindowsFeature Server-Gui-Mgmt-Infra, Server-Gui-Shell -Restart
- 需重启生效,安装后通过远程桌面(RDP)连接即可使用。
- 注意:此操作需系统盘剩余空间≥5GB。
方法二:通过阿里云控制台重装系统
- 进入ECS实例详情页,选择"更换操作系统"。
- 在镜像市场搜索"Windows Server with Desktop"或选择官方提供的Desktop Experience版本。
图形化界面的优缺点
优点 | 缺点 |
---|---|
便于可视化操作(如IIS配置) | 资源占用高(内存增加30%+) |
适合不熟悉命令行的用户 | 潜在安全风险(如RDP爆破攻击) |
支持部分依赖GUI的软件 | 需额外维护补丁和依赖 |
替代方案:无GUI下的管理工具
- WinRM+PowerShell:通过脚本实现批量管理。
- Windows Admin Center:微软提供的免费Web管理工具。
- 第三方工具:如Ansible、Chef等自动化平台。
建议与总结
- 生产环境优先使用Core模式:图形化界面非必需时,应保持最小化安装以提升性能与安全性。
- 临时需要GUI可按需安装,但长期运行建议通过命令行或工具替代。
- 阿里云未预装GUI是出于通用性考虑,用户可根据实际需求灵活调整。